Job Description
Description
The Production Foreman is responsible for leading employees, scheduling work activities, ensuring quality of workmanship, training and educating employees on safety guidelines, company policies, and production equipment. Responsible for productivity and quality management. Recommends equipment upgrades, staffing adjustments, process modifications. This position reports to the Production Manager.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Execute production schedule
  • Maintains safe operations by adhering to safety procedures and regulations
  • Hold employees to Company Safety guidelines and procedures
  • Train and coach new employees
  • Is actively engaged in solving problems as they arise
  • Maximize output throughout the department on all equipment, meeting or exceeding production goals
  • Ensure that product being produced meets all quality standards
  • Directs and supervises the work of multiple employees across multiple departments
  • Ensure that all steps are being made to ensure shipping integrity and accuracy
  • Establish and maintain an environment that promotes teamwork
  • Works with Maintenance department to facilitate repair of equipment
  • Ensures employees maintain a neat and orderly working environment
  • Coordinates manpower requirements by increasing or decreasing personnel and overtime to meet changing conditions
  • Recommends measures to improve safety, production methods and quality of product
  • Develops and implements plans to motivate workers to achieve production goals
